Summary
Vineland Elementary is a public elementary school in Bakersfield, California, serving 346 students in grades K-4. The school is part of the Vineland Elementary School District, which is ranked 1378 out of 1565 districts in the state and has a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ger.
Vineland Elementary consistently ranks in the bottom 10-15% of California elementary schools based on statewide rankings, with its academic performance, as measured by Smarter Balanced Assessments, significantly below the state average across all grade levels and subject areas. For example, in 2024-2025, only 23.85% of Vineland Elementary students were proficient or better in English Language Arts/Literacy, compared to the state average of 48.81%. The school's performance is particularly low in mathematics, with only 14.42% of students proficient or better, compared to the state average of 37.3%. Vineland Elementary also has consistently high chronic absenteeism rates, ranging from 15.7% to 24.9% over the past few years, significantly higher than the state average.
Interestingly, the nearby schools, such as Valle Verde Elementary, Crescent Elementary, and General Shafter Elementary, generally perform better academically than Vineland Elementary, with higher proficiency rates in both English Language Arts and Mathematics, as well as lower chronic absenteeism rates and a lower percentage of students from low-socioeconomic backgrounds. Despite the significant increase in spending per student at Vineland Elementary, from $11,896 in 2020-2021 to $22,318 in 2023-2024, the school's academic performance has remained consistently low, suggesting that simply increasing funding may not be the sole solution to improving student outcomes.
